1907. As Tata Steel began to manufacture steel, and in Surat, the Indian National Congress split into moderates and radicals, a momentous priestly change of guard occurred. A most illustrious Zoroastrian High Priest, who had occupied the dasturi (seat of divine authority) for 34 years, suddenly passed away at 50. His son, only 13, had the white cotton pichhori (white belt/girdle) bestowed upon him at his father’s uthamna.
